Understanding Your Credit Rating


Overview


Many people don’t give it much thought, but each of us has a computer file containing our credit history. This file includes details like current and past addresses, income levels, outstanding debts, and available credit. It also tracks repayment habits, bill payment punctuality, and any county court judgments for payments.

Who Uses Credit Reports?


Credit reports are accessible to various companies for a fee, and many utilize them regularly. Traditionally, banks and lenders used these reports to make loan decisions. Nowadays, rental agencies often require a credit check to ensure timely rent payments. Insurance companies assess credit reports to determine premiums, and even large employers may screen job applicants using this information.

As you can see, your credit rating significantly influences numerous aspects of your life. You might not consider an unpaid phone bill after moving to be a major issue, but it can have serious repercussions.

Tips for Maintaining a Healthy Credit Rating


To ensure a strong credit rating, consider the following steps:

- Pay Bills on Time: Timely payments are crucial.
- Reduce Outstanding Debt: Lower your debt to improve your credit profile.

Remember, time is on your side. Most negative marks on your report don’t last forever.

Checking Your Credit Report


You’re entitled to view your credit report, and doing so helps ensure its accuracy. If you find any errors, you can request corrections. Credit reporting agencies are obligated to maintain accurate and up-to-date information, so promptly inform them of any discrepancies and provide the correct details.

By understanding and managing your credit history, you can make informed financial decisions and protect your financial wellbeing.
